Actually, that Z weights 3500 lbs. and was rated at (probably an over-estimated) 300bhp. The RSX is 660 lbs lighter at 2840lbs and has 210hp.

Considering the mods and power to weight ratio, the Z should have pulled more. My guess is that the Z is not properly tuned.
